#48c5b2 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#48c5b2 is composed of 28.2% red, 77.3% green and 69.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 63.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 9.6% yellow and 22.7% black. It has a hue angle of 170.9 degrees, a saturation of 51.9% and a lightness of 52.7%. #48c5b2 color hex could be obtained by blending #90ffff with #008b65. Closest websafe color is: #33cc99.

Shades and Tints of #48c5b2

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030b0a is the darkest color, while #fbfef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#48c5b2

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#808d8b is the less saturated color, while #10fdd9 is the most saturated one.
